When choosing a suitable journal for publication, there are several tips that can be highly helpful in the selection process. Firstly, it’s important to identify the focus areas and scope of the journal to ensure that the paper aligns with the journal’s thematic and subject coverage. Secondly, the journal’s impact factor and bibliometric indicators should be taken into account to determine the potential readership and exposure of the paper. Thirdly, it is advisable to review and analyze the publishing guidelines and policies of the target journal to ensure the paper meets all the requirements and formatting instructions. Moreover, considering the submission and review process, publication fees, and copyright policies can help determine the suitability of the journal. Finally, consulting with colleagues and experienced academics in the field can provide reliable recommendations and insights on the selection of the most appropriate journal for the research paper.

Another important consideration in publishing research papers is the choice of journal. Not all journals are created equal, and finding the right one will increase the likelihood of acceptance, citation, and impact. The first step in selecting a journal is to determine the scope and audience of the research. Researchers must consider whether their work aligns with the scope of the journal and the interests of its readers. Additionally, they should examine the journal’s reputation, impact factor, open-access policy, and publication fee. It is important to note that the most prestigious journals may have a higher rejection rate, longer review process, and more stringent requirements. However, publishing in a high-impact journal can boost a researcher’s career and visibility in the academic community.
Guidelines for formatting and structuring research papers are critical elements to ensure the effectiveness of a research paper. Most importantly, these guidelines help readers to easily understand the content and navigate through the paper smoothly. The structure of the research paper must be logical, starting with an introduction that outlines the study’s purpose and its significance. The paper should also include a literature review that places the research’s findings in context. Besides, the methodology, results, and discussion sections should accurately and objectively present the research data and analysis. It is also essential to reference all sources cited in the paper appropriately and consistently follow the citation style guidelines specified by the instructor or the editor. By adhering to these guidelines, authors can produce a comprehensive and well-structured research paper for publication.

The importance of peer review cannot be overstated. Peer review is a crucial step in the publication process as it ensures the quality and rigor of research. The peer review process involves subjecting a manuscript to scrutiny by experts in the same field as the author. These experts provide feedback on the validity of the research, the interpretation of results, and its relevance to the field of study. This feedback is critical to the author as it allows them to improve their manuscript, and ensures that their work meets the standards of the scientific community. Peer review is an essential mechanism for maintaining the integrity of research and ensuring that only high-quality work is published. It also allows for open discussion and debate within the scientific community, leading to further advancements in the field.
